Where is The Ankara Hotel?
Where is The Ankara Hotel located?
The Ankara Hotel, The Ankara Hotel, Turkey (approx. 39.93389°, 32.8435°)
Where is The Ankara Hotel on the map?
The Ankara Hotel - Ankara Airport
{"latitude":39.93389,"longitude":32.8435,"title":"The Ankara Hotel"}